Western Tablet and Stationery Company, Building No. 2

It is a six-story, reinforced concrete frame and brick masonry building on a raised basement.

It was designed with Prairie School style-derived influence.

The St. Joseph facility was closed in 2004.

[2]: 5, 10 It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 2007.
